The maximum salary for an Electrical and Electronics Engineering (EEE) engineer can vary widely depending on factors like location, industry, level of experience, and the specific role they hold. Here's a general breakdown:
1. **Entry-Level (0-2 years of experience)**:
- In countries like the US, India, or Europe, entry-level EEE engineers might earn anywhere from **$50,000 to $80,000 per year** or **₹4-6 Lakh per year** in India.
2. **Mid-Level (3-5 years of experience)**:
- With some experience, salaries typically range between **$70,000 to $100,000 per year** in the US or **₹6-10 Lakh per year** in India.
3. **Senior-Level/Experienced (5-10 years of experience)**:
- Experienced engineers, especially in specialized or management roles, could earn anywhere from **$100,000 to $150,000+ per year** in countries like the US or **₹10-20 Lakh per year** in India.
4. **Top Positions (10+ years of experience, managerial, or high-end specialized roles)**:
- Senior positions or roles in top multinational companies can bring salaries of **$150,000 to $250,000+** per year in the US or **₹20-50 Lakh per year** in India. These roles may include senior engineering positions, project managers, or technical leads in global companies.
These are just averages and can vary. For example, working in sectors like **oil & gas**, **telecom**, **renewable energy**, or **automation** might offer higher salaries, while startups or academia might offer lower compensation.
Geography also plays a huge role—engineers in the US, Canada, Europe, or Australia generally earn higher salaries compared to those in developing nations.
